The Benefits Of Using A Water Fed Pole For Window Cleaning

Cleaning windows can be a tedious and time-consuming task, especially when trying to reach those hard-to-access areas. Traditional methods of window cleaning often involve ladders, squeegees, and buckets of soapy water. However, there is a more efficient and safer alternative that many professional window cleaners are turning to – the water fed pole.

A water fed pole is a versatile tool that is used to clean windows, solar panels, and other surfaces at heights. It consists of a telescopic pole that can extend to various lengths, along with a brush head at the end. The brush head is fitted with soft bristles that gently scrub away dirt and grime, while water is constantly fed through the pole to rinse the surface clean.

One of the main advantages of using a water fed pole for window cleaning is its ability to reach high and difficult-to-access areas without the need for ladders or scaffolding. This not only makes the job safer for the cleaner but also reduces the risk of damage to the property. With a water fed pole, windows on upper floors or in awkward locations can be cleaned quickly and efficiently, saving time and effort.

Another benefit of using a water fed pole is the superior cleaning results it provides. The constant flow of purified water ensures that windows are left streak-free and spotless, without the need for additional chemicals or detergents. The soft bristles of the brush head are gentle on glass surfaces, making it ideal for cleaning delicate windows, such as those in conservatories or skylights.
